A NEW GENERATION REFUSING CHILD MARRIAGE

By Othieno Gerald | Project Leader

Dear Friends,

A powerful movement is growing in rural Uganda. Thanks to your support, a new generation of girls is finding the confidence, knowledge, and determination to reject child marriage and pursue education instead.

This reporting period, girls participating in our project continued to strengthen their leadership and life skills through mentorship activities. They learned about goal setting, decision-making, personal rights, and the importance of education in creating opportunities for the future.

Many participants openly discussed their dreams and aspirations, expressing a strong desire to complete school and build independent lives. Their determination reflects a growing shift in attitudes among young people and communities.

Parents and local leaders joined awareness sessions that highlighted the risks of child marriage and the long-term benefits of educating girls. These conversations encouraged greater support for girls' rights and educational opportunities.

Teachers reported positive changes in attendance, participation, and confidence among students involved in project activities. Girls are increasingly becoming advocates for themselves and for others facing similar challenges.

The most inspiring outcome is the growing belief among girls that they have the right to choose their own futures. They are challenging harmful norms and embracing opportunities that previous generations often lacked.

Thank you for helping nurture a generation that is choosing education, opportunity, and hope over child marriage.
